How to Configure AMD Zen 5 CPUs and Resolve Installer USB Mapping Stalls
Attempting to install macOS Sequoia on a Ryzen 5 9600X (AMD Zen 5 architecture) paired with a Radeon RX 6600 XT and a Gigabyte B850M motherboard can trigger a prohibited symbol (🚫) after selecting the installer. This behaviour occurs because of missing Zen 5 kernel patches or USB controller drops.
1. Prerequisites
- Hardware Specs: AMD Ryzen 5 9600X, Gigabyte B850M AORUS Elite, AMD Radeon RX 6600 XT, 16GB DDR5.
- Required Patches: Latest AMD OS X kernel patches (Zen 5 compatibility updates).
- Required Kexts: Lilu, VirtualSMC, WhateverGreen, AMDRyzenCPUPowerManagement.
2. Compatibility Snapshot
- Ryzen 9000: Compatible, but requires CPU ID spoofing and updated patches, as macOS has no native AMD CPU definitions.
- XhciPortLimit Warning: The
XhciPortLimitquirk is broken in macOS Sequoia and will cause a prohibitory symbol. It must be set to False.
3. Installation Preparation
- BIOS Configurations: Disable Secure Boot, CSM, Fast Boot, and XHCI Hand-off. Enable Above 4G Decoding.
4. EFI and config.plist Review
- Ryzen CPU Patches: Open config.plist using ProperTree. Go to Kernel -> Patch, and update the AMD CPU patches to the latest release. Update the core count patches to match your 6-core Ryzen 5 9600X (hex value
06). - Disable XhciPortLimit: Under Kernel -> Quirks, set
XhciPortLimittoFalse. UseUSBToolBox.kextandUTBMap.kextto map ports instead. - SMBIOS Profile: Change the SMBIOS from iMacPro1,1 to
MacPro7,1(which is more compatible with AMD Zen 5 hardware profiles).
5. Post-Installation
- CPU Power Management: Configure AMD CPU Friend to enable proper power stepping.
6. Troubleshooting
Reported Issue: Prohibitory symbol on boot
- Stuck on USB loading: The prohibited sign indicates the USB port mapping has failed. Ensure your USB ports are mapped correctly in the EFI folder and that the installer USB is plugged into a USB 2.0 port.
7. Dual Boot and Advanced Configuration
- Dual booting Windows and macOS Sequoia works natively. Keep the OS installations on separate NVMe SSDs.
8. Verification, Maintenance and Rollback
- Verify Fix: Boot verbose (
-v) and verify the installer screen loads.
